0
A
回答
4
为此使用number_format
。它将返回一个字符串,从而保持小数位不变,即使它们是.00
。
$price = 15900;
// Defaults to a comma as a thousands separator
// but I've set it to an empty string (last argument)
$formatted = number_format($price/100, 2, '.', '');
echo $formatted;
或者更好的,也许看看money_format
以及根据国际符号和/或货币符号是否是重要的为好。
1
$current = 15900;
$your = round($current/100, 2);
相关问题
- 1. 将货币格式转换为数字
- 2. FoxPro将货币转换为数字
- 3. 如何将货币转换为数字?
- 4. 将货币转换为长值的字
- 5. 将C#货币转换为字符串
- 6. 通过PHP将MySQL数字转换为货币?
- 7. javascript将货币转换为数千
- 8. 将整数转换为货币
- 9. PHP函数将数字转换成货币格式
- 10. 转换货币
- 11. 将货币/货币转换为Cent,反之亦然
- 12. 计算后将双货币转换为货币
- 13. 将货币名称转换为货币符号
- 14. 将字符串转换为货币格式的数字JavaScript
- 15. 如何将货币字符串转换为数字
- 16. 将字符串中的数字转换为货币格式
- 17. 转换为货币格式
- 18. 转换为货币格式
- 19. C++转换为货币值
- 20. 转换成ISO 4217的数字货币代码货币名称
- 21. 将NVARCHAR转换为货币值
- 22. 将int转换为货币格式
- 23. Java将长转换为货币
- 24. F#将货币从Excel转换为
- 25. 如何将货币转换为Decimal vb.net?
- 26. 如何将int转换为货币?
- 27. 将NSString转换为货币格式
- 28. SQL将varchar转换为货币
- 29. 将货币$ 232,680.00转换为十进制
- 30. 货币对数转换轨
'15931'会发生什么,它是否也是'159.31'? – Shef
将它作为'15900'并视为美分而不是美元。在津巴布韦,款待是百万Z $,而不是千兆Z $。 –
也可以在数字中显示00吗?例如159.00或164.78 – JackTheJack